Output 58d277cde012a8de9959ae55a1990a63083f0a61a2f30d22778965329ddf7f28:1

value
506340
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11aae96be3b59f8e53a5256c33fa8e1c35313343 OP_EQUALVERIFY OP_CHECKSIG
address
mh8NXUXNYvAZ1GwCnFozmdMftSXVk6KpBn
transaction
58d277cde012a8de9959ae55a1990a63083f0a61a2f30d22778965329ddf7f28
confirmations
98460
spent
true